CP RACHAKONDA ARRANGED THIRD GRAND WELCOME TO CORONA CONQUERORS IN RACHAKONDA COMMISSIONARATE

Hyderabad Jul 28 (PMI): The Commissioner of Police Rachakonda has arranged a third grand welcome to the 45 Covid 19 Conquerors of Rachakonda Police Commissionerate on today Rachakonda Commissionerate at Neredmet.

The Covid 19 defeaters namely Sri T. Kiran Kumar CI of Nacharam PS, Sri R. Saidulu DEFETERS DI of Chaitanyapuri PS, Smt G.Sandhya SI of Chaitnyapuri PS, Sri L.Ravikumar SI of Saroornagar PS, Sri Danunjaya SI of Ghatkesar PS and others have been grand welcomed by the Police Band and amidst applause by officers of Rachakonda.

The Police personnel who had defeated Covid 19 and got recovery each one shared their experience specially elucidating the process of recovery through coping with the stress of being detected by Covid 19, the confidence built by team of doctors, their colleagues at office and their officers. All of them expressed their sincere gratitude to the Sri Mahesh Bhagwat IPS CP Rachakonda for calling each of them personally and instilling confidence and Dr Avinash for providing best treatment possible to each of them and also pursuing the treatment right from the date of detection. They said that their families are also happy for the gesture of Rachakonda Police in depositing Rs 5000 fund in their account & sending chawanprash, dry fruits, medicine kit even after discharge from hospital or isolation. All of them stressed the importance of building immunity through proper diet, medicines, home remedies like steam, warm water gargling and being mentally strong.  All the Covid-19 conquerors were felicitated by the officers of Rachakonda.

Sri Sudheer Babu IPS, Addl CP Rachakonda stated that the affected officers should neither be over confident nor negligent but be cautious and follow medication and exercise which suits them. He said that we should surrender to fear but instead overcome the disease with confidence.

Sri Mahesh Bhagwat IPS CP Rachakonda while addressing the covid conquerors of Rachakonda stated that all the officers have been mentally strong and have created their own destiny with the support of family and with a strong will power that they have overcome the disease and joined the duty. He stated that in a similar manner the other officers who are now undergoing treatment will also emerge victorious in the fight against Covid. He said that we should not feel guilty of getting affected with Covid19 & Happiness is the best medicine to boost immunity he said.  He stated that Rachakonda Police have conducted medical examination of officers with comorbidities and 20 of them have been given rest. He suggested jalneti kriya, meditation, drinking warm water, taking warm and fresh food, not to be overconfident and have all supplied medicines by Ayush and vitamin tablets, turmeric milk and consult medical team as soon as there are symptoms.

He cautioned all the recovered staff to take the immunity boosting medicines of vit C, zinc and D3 and also homeo medicine being provided by the CP Office. He also advised all staff and their family members to follow a daily routine which is prescribed in a poster designed for the purpose and that it will be circulated to all.  CP reiterated that we have to live with the Covid19 virus till there is medicine for same and so we have to adopt a new and healthy life style to be healthy and be resilient. He encouraged the recovered officers to come forward and donate plasma and be life saviours for critical patients of Covid 19.
